The invention discloses a multi-source signal fusion early warning method for a reciprocating compressor. The method comprises the following steps: (1) acquiring full-period data under a specified representative load; (2) calculating a mechanism feature vector of the whole period data; (3) calculating a feature vector of representative loads; (4) calculating the similarity of adjacent representative loads; (5) combining the representative loads with similar features; a dynamic pressure signal and an indicator diagram in the cylinder are subjected to multi-source signal fusion diagnosis, and the reliability is good; the working load interval of the reciprocating compressor is divided into gear intervals, representative loads are selected from the gear intervals, signal abnormity diagnosis is carried out on new full-period signals under new loads belonging to the representative load intervals or the gear intervals on the basis of the multiple specified representative loads, and the method is good in flexibility, scientific and efficient.

technical field [0001] The present application relates to the technical field of equipment state monitoring and diagnosis, in particular to a multi-source signal fusion early warning method for a reciprocating compressor. Background technique [0002] The reciprocating compressor is the heart of many key mechanical systems. Once a serious failure occurs, the entire equipment system will fail or be damaged. Because the structure of the reciprocating compressor is very complex, the working conditions are changeable, and the working conditions are very bad, which leads to a high failure rate. Therefore, when an abnormal signal occurs, it is an urgent problem to give an early warning to prevent the deterioration of the failure and improve reliability and safety. .
